UTI Stock Analysis - Frequently Asked Questions

Universal Technical Institute's stock was trading at $26.11 at the start of the year. Since then, UTI shares have increased by 51.6% and is now trading at $39.5720.

Universal Technical Institute Inc (NYSE:UTI) issued its earnings results on Wednesday, May, 6th. The company reported $0.01 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.00 by $0.01. The firm earned $221.40 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$221.61 million. Universal Technical Institute had a net margin of 4.91% and a trailing twelve-month return on equity of 13.02%.
